The top 5 signs that indicate a roof needs repair or replacement in Fort Worth are:

Recognizing critical signs of roof damage early helps prevent expensive repairs. The following are the primary indicators owners should monitor:

  1. Discoloration on ceilings or walls: This often signifies water damage, which can lead to mold growth and structural issues.
  2. Missing or broken shingles: If shingles are compromised, your roof’s protection against leaks is diminished.
  3. Granules in gutters: The presence of granules can indicate that your shingles are deteriorating, which might lead to them needing replacement.
  4. Visible cracks or sagging: These physical deformities in your roof’s structure are alarming and may require immediate professional repair.
  5. Frequent leaks in different areas: Ongoing leaks can signify systemic failure within your roofing material and may necessitate a full replacement.

How Does Severe Weather Impact Your Fort Worth Roof’s Condition?

Stormy weather impacting a residential roof, illustrating the urgency of roof maintenance during severe conditions

Severe weather can significantly degrade roofing materials. Typical effects include:

  • Hailstorms can damage shingles severely: Heavy hail can create dents and holes in roofing materials, leading to leaks.
  • High winds may remove or lift shingles: Wind can compromise the seal of shingles, allowing water to infiltrate.
  • Extreme heat causes premature aging of roofing materials: Constant exposure can lead to warping, cracking, and general deterioration.

Understanding these impacts supports proactive maintenance to reduce the risk of costly repairs.

How Can You Determine If Your Roof Needs Replacement Versus Repair?

Choosing repair or replacement depends on several factors. Consider the following when evaluating your options:

  • Consider the age of the roof and extent of damage: Older roofs may require replacement, while newer ones may only need repairs.
  • Previous repairs impact the decision: If your roof has already undergone multiple repairs, replacement might be more cost-effective.
  • Cost-effectiveness plays a crucial role: Assess whether the cost of frequent repairs exceeds that of a new roof installation.

A careful evaluation prevents unnecessary costs and supports long-term roof performance.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How often should I inspect my roof for damage?

Inspect your roof at least twice a year—ideally in spring and fall—and after extreme weather events. Regular checks catch early signs of wear so you can address issues before they escalate into costly repairs.

2. Can I perform roof repairs myself, or should I hire a professional?

Minor repairs may be manageable for homeowners with the right tools and safety measures, but hire a professional for major issues. Professionals assess and repair damage safely, ensure compliance with building codes, and can prevent further problems that increase costs.

3. How do I know if I need a roof replacement instead of just repairs?

Consider roof age, extent of damage, and repair costs. Roofs older than about 20 years with multiple problem areas often warrant replacement. A roofing professional can recommend the most cost-effective solution for your situation.

4. What types of roofs are most susceptible to damage from severe weather?

Asphalt shingle roofs are common and typically more vulnerable to wind and hail. Tile and metal roofs may also suffer weather damage, especially if improperly installed or aged. Regular inspections and maintenance help reduce risk across roof types.

5. Are there specific signs that indicate long-term water damage?

Long-term water damage often appears as extensive discoloration on ceilings and walls, mold growth, or sagging roof or ceiling sections. These signs usually indicate prolonged water infiltration and may require major repairs or replacement.

6. What should I do if I notice a leak in my roof?

Contain the leak by placing a bucket or container under the drip to limit interior damage, then call a roofing professional. A qualified contractor will locate the source and recommend repairs to prevent further issues.

7. How can I improve my roof’s durability against weather conditions?

Improve durability with regular inspections, gutter cleaning, and timely repair of minor issues. Selecting high-quality materials for replacement and ensuring proper ventilation will also help reduce moisture buildup and extend your roof’s lifespan.
